Maintaining a safe distance during a vehicle fire incident is essential for protecting the crew from potential fire hazards. Vehicle fires can produce unpredictable flames, toxic smoke, and explosions due to various flammable materials in and around the vehicle. By keeping a safe distance, firefighters minimize their exposure to these hazards, ensuring their safety while they assess and combat the fire. This distance allows for maneuverability and the ability to strategize their approach without putting themselves at unnecessary risk.
